Default Re: Proposed Group Buy: Unichip P&P Tuner For 07+ Tundra & All Toyo Trucks & Suvs

Quote:
Originally Posted by 07bsmcrewmax View Post
Will this affect warranty in any way? Can it be removed if taken to the dealer so as it is not detectable? If dyno sheets look good and warranty will not be affected, count me in!
No, it is a piggy back system that is undetectable by dealers. it can easily be removed since there is a harness for it. The dealer will never know.

Default Re: Proposed Group Buy: Unichip P&P Tuner For 07+ Tundra & All Toyo Trucks & Suvs

Quote:
Originally Posted by Tundradrenalin View Post
still waiting on an answer to this question...
Okay Tundrenalin, here is the answer to your question. Basically one is Flux-equipped, the other is not. See comments below.

The only diffrance is flux. I could tell you about flux all day long. If you visit our website and click on the flux link you will learn what you need. Also understand we are working on the new OBDII CAN system which all 07-08 toyota have. Untill we unlock the code flux will not be sold with the kits. You can purchase it and we will ship them as an upgrade. Flux is great fun and gives end user abilities that don't have with others tuners. Keep in mind flux does not include the PDA, the customer must purchase it for someone else.


I will be back in town Friday to help out more!
Mike Timmons Western Regional Sales Director
Unichip of North America
www.unichip.us
503.539.2672

Flux is amazing! It's tuning software for PDA's. A few features are:

+Display, measure, record and play real-time engine performance data
+Wireless Bluetooth Connectivity
+5 user-selectable performance calibrations
+Scan, read & clear Diagnostic Trouble Codes
+Valet mode RPM Limiter
+Password protected vehicle immobilizer
+Virtual Dynamometer
+Measure acceleration times
+Drag strip with elapsed time, trap speed
+Lap Timer
+Tire Size Correction
+User-selectable shift lights

*EDIT* Currently with the Flux, you will have the ability to choose from 5 different preset maps, but those maps must be downloaded from Unichip or a certified tuner. Unichip will release software in the near future which will allow end users to customize maps.



Unichip - Flux Power Display

I'm still waiting on him to verify that the 4.7 is supported. If it isn't yet, it definitely will be before this group buy is completed.
